Thyme And Onion Muffins – a delicious recipe with butter, onion, thyme, flour, bran, baking powder. Easy to follow and perfect for any occasion.

1
Melt butter in a small saucepan over medium heat.
2
Add in onion and cook 4-5 minutes, stirring several times until tender; remove from heat.
3
Crumble thyme leaves into the saucepan and stir into the butter.
4
Heat oven to 400u00b0; grease muffin cups, or use foil or paper baking cups.
5
Thoroughly mix flour, oat bran, baking powder, salt, and pepper in a large bowl.
6
Beat egg in a small bowl; whisk in milk.
7
Add onion and herb mixture; pour over dry ingredients.
8
Mix gently with a rubber spatula, just until dry ingredients are moistened.
9
Scoop batter into muffin cups.
10
Bake 20-25 minutes, until tinged with brown and no longer damp in the center.
11
Cool in pans for 10 minutes before turning out onto a rack.
